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Role Overview
The Mobile Developer is part of the front-end development team and will be responsible for developing and implementing user interface components using React Native concepts and workflows. You need to have a great blend of Javascript and native platform skills. They will be working on the front-end part of the app and, at the same time, possess knowledge of API services and cross-platform compatibility along with the infrastructure of the application for integration. The role also involves profiling and improving front-end performance, documenting our codebase and requires an excellent understanding of progressive web applications.
Responsibilities
- Developing Qashio’s mobile app on iOS and Android platforms using React/React Native with clean code
- Implementing pixel-perfect UIs and components that adhere to agreed designs
- Integrating the mobile app with third-party or in-house APIs
- Writing automated tests to ensure error-free code, performance stability and security of structures
- Implementing clean, modern, smooth animations and transitions geared towards an excellent user experience
- Creating front-end modules with maximum code reusability and efficiency
- Diagnosing and fixing bugs and performance bottlenecks to ensure seamless front-end performance
- Releasing and updating versions of the app to the stores
- Participating and contributing to regular team sprints and stand-ups
- Collaborating with internal mobile development team members as well as other Tech and Product team members in an agile environment and in compliance with stipulated timelines
Qualifications and Experience
- 3+ years of experience in front-end development and a proven track record of working on scalable mobile applications
- Proficiency in technologies/languages including ReactJS and React Native, and knowledge of tools and workflows like Webpack, Enzyme, Redux, Flux, Babel, etc.
- Experience in modern authorization mechanism such as JSON web token
- Rock solid at working with third-party dependencies, performance testing and browser-based debugging software
- Excellent troubleshooting and project management skills
- A degree in computer science, information technology or related discipline
- Demonstrated experience, exposure and interest in the FinTech space. Having worked with a Fintech company will be a big advantage.
- A good understanding of accounting and expense management systems
- Familiarity with collaboration and communication tools such as Slack, Zoom, Google Teams, Asana, Trello
Essential Competencies
- Technical problem-solving
- Data-based decision-making
- Analytical ability
- Cross-functional collaboration
- Communication skills
- Stakeholder management
Key Skills
Ranked by relevanceReady to apply?
Join Qashio and take your career to the next level!
Application takes less than 5 minutes

